Introducing the stunning 2005 Formula 330 Sun Sport, a remarkable cruiser that combines performance and elegance. With an overall length of 33 feet, this vessel is designed for thrilling adventures on the water. Its deep Vee hull, crafted from durable fiberglass, ensures a smooth and stable ride, making it perfect for both leisurely cruising and spirited outings. Powered by twin MerCruiser 6.2 MPI Bravo III engines, each delivering 320 horsepower, this boat reaches impressive cruising speeds of 35 mph and a maximum hull speed of 50 mph. The inboard/outboard configuration enhances maneuverability, while the stainless steel 3-blade propellers provide efficient propulsion. Inside, you'll find a cozy cabin and a well-appointed head, ensuring comfort during your journeys. The manual windlass adds convenience for anchoring. Overview
The Formula 330 SunSport represents 46 years of excellence and tradition, offering a unique blend of offshore performance and cruising amenities. Introduced in 2003, this model occupies a niche between Formula's offshore and cruising boats, making it an ideal day boat for those seeking both speed and comfort. Notably, the 330 SunSport features options such as a stainless steel windshield and fiberglass arch, enhancing its sleek and stylish design.
Exterior Design and Deck Features
The 330 SunSport boasts a performance-proven hull with distinctive Enron hull side graphics and coordinated topside appointments that emphasize both style and function. The boat’s 33-foot overall length and 10-foot 2-inch beam provide a stable and spacious platform. Molded-in steps leading to the bow offer secure footing and additional seating when entertaining. The cockpit is designed as a social hub, featuring a large ski locker beneath the lounge for storing water sports equipment, a molded fiberglass galley with a 54-quart Igloo cooler, integrated sink with covers, and ample lounge seating around a double table that converts into a large sunbed. The expansive swim platform includes convenient amenities such as a transom shower, telescoping ladder, stereo controls, and dockside connections.
Interior Living Spaces
Below deck, the cabin offers a comfortable and well-appointed environment with 5 feet 7 inches of headroom. The portside galley includes a microwave, refrigerator, and an in-counter trash receptacle, complemented by an illuminated locker for easy access to provisions. Entertainment is provided by a Kenwood AM-FM CD stereo system with two 100-watt marine speakers. The salon features a luxurious ultra-leather U-shaped dinette lounge that converts into a double berth, providing versatile sleeping accommodations. The private head compartment is equipped with a manually operated toilet connected to a 26-gallon holding tank, a molded vanity with sink, a retractable showerhead faucet, and an exhaust fan. The interior finishes include burl wood and brushed metallic accents, creating an elegant atmosphere.
Helm and Instrumentation
The helm station is a blend of artistry and functionality, featuring a burl wood and brushed metallic dash panel. Backlit BDO Ocean instrumentation and a digital depth finder provide clear, easy-to-read data in various lighting conditions. Controls such as waterproof rocker switches and levers are ergonomically placed within easy reach, including separate stereo controls at the helm. This well-designed command center ensures precise handling and convenient operation, making it the focal point for both navigation and social interaction.
Power and Performance
The Formula 330 SunSport offers twin engine options and weighs approximately 9,700 pounds. It features a generous fuel capacity of 120 gallons, supporting extended outings. Performance testing revealed rapid acceleration, with the boat planing in 4.9 seconds and reaching 30 miles per hour in 7 seconds. The optimal cruising speed was found to be around 29 miles per hour at 3,000 RPM, consuming 18.7 gallons per hour and providing a range of approximately 170 miles. At full throttle, the boat achieved speeds exceeding 53 miles per hour at 4,900 RPM, with a range of about 120 miles between refueling stops. Handling is characterized by the control and responsiveness expected from Formula’s design pedigree.

The Biggest Pros and Cons
The 2005 Formula 330 Sun Sport offers a blend of performance, comfort, and style, making it a popular choice for boating enthusiasts. Here are some pros and cons to consider:
Pros
Powerful Performance: Equipped with robust engines, the 330 Sun Sport delivers impressive speed and smooth handling.
Spacious Layout: The open cockpit design provides ample seating and socializing space, ideal for entertaining guests.
Quality Construction: Known for its solid build and attention to detail, ensuring durability and longevity.
Comfortable Amenities: Features such as a well-appointed cabin, a functional galley, and a private head enhance onboard comfort.
Versatile Use: Suitable for day cruising, watersports, and overnight trips thanks to its thoughtful design and amenities.
Cons
Fuel Consumption: With its powerful engines, fuel efficiency may be lower compared to smaller or less performance-oriented boats.
Cabin Size: While comfortable for day trips and short stays, the cabin space might feel limited for extended cruising or larger groups.
Maintenance Costs: High-performance boats like the 330 Sun Sport can incur higher maintenance and upkeep expenses.
Maneuverability in Tight Spaces: Due to its size, handling in very tight docks or congested marinas may require skill and caution.
